Ingredients

Units Scale

3 (15 oz) cans chickpeas, drained and rinsed

1 large cucumber, chopped

2 medium bell peppers, chopped

1 pint cherry tomatoes, halved

1/2 red onion, chopped

1 (6 oz) can kalamata olives (about 1 cup)

1/2 cup chopped parsley, more to taste (I typically will do a little more)

1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il

2 tbsp red wine vinegar

1/2 large lemon, juiced

1 tsp dried oregano

1/2 tsp salt

1/4 tsp ground black pepper

(optional for spice) 1 tsp red pepper flakes

Instructions

  1. Drain and rinse the cans of chickpeas.
  2. Chop the vegetables.
  3. In a large bowl, toss together all of the ingredients.
  4. Toss again just before serving to reincorporate the oil, vinegar, and lemon juice that likely settled to the bottom.
